History of copper - through the ages from the Copper Age,

The Copper Age The Sumerians and Chaldeans. Copper first came into use as the earliest non-precious metal employed by the Sumerians and Chaldeans of Mesopotamia, after they had established their thriving cities of Sumer and Accad, Ur, al’Ubaid and others somewhere between 5000 and 6000 years ago.

Evaporation, filtration and crystallisation | CPD | RSC,

May 23, 2018· Making hydrated copper sulfate crystals from copper oxide and sulfuric acid [£, pdf] requires all of the filtration, evaporation and crystallisation techniques. 24 React copper oxide with hot sulfuric acid. Filter the mixture to remove unreacted copper oxide, then heat the filtrate to evaporate off about half the water.

Environmental impact of estrogens on human, animal and,

Feb 01, 2017· Plant root structure is well understood comprising the epidermis, cortex, endodermis and vascular tissue containing xylem and phloem. Water and solutes are moved upward from the root into other plant parts through the xylem by mass flow due to a pressure gradient created throughout the plant during transpiration.
